Choosing The Right Materials

Paint selection for a side mirror is critical, as the material must adhere to plastic or metal and withstand environmental conditions. A high-quality automotive paint with UV protection is recommended. An adhesion promoter is key for plastic surfaces, ensuring the paint sticks properly. Pair the paint with a compatible primer; a self-etching primer works well for metal surfaces, while a plastic primer is essential for plastic mirrors. Ensure both paint and primer are suitable for the mirror’s material.

Assembling all necessary tools before starting the painting process can save time and improve efficiency. Essential items include sandpaper (of varying grits), a tack cloth, masking tape, and protective gear such as gloves and a respirator mask. Using a drop cloth or newspaper to protect surrounding areas from overspray is also advisable. For an optimal finish, consider acquiring a paint sprayer, although spray cans may suffice for smaller jobs.

Proper surface preparation is vital to achieving a professional-looking paint job. Begin by cleaning the side mirror with a degreasing agent to remove dirt, oils, and contaminants. Follow up with sanding the surface with a fine-grit sandpaper to create a smooth base for the primer to adhere to. After sanding, wipe down the mirror with a tack cloth to remove any residual dust. Apply masking tape carefully around areas that are not to be painted, guaranteeing crisp paint lines and protecting other parts of the vehicle.

Step-by-step Painting Process

Preparing the side mirror for painting is essential for a flawless finish. Begin by sanding the surface with fine-grit sandpaper to remove imperfections and create a smooth area for the paint to adhere. Ensure all dust and debris are wiped clean before moving on to the next step.

Priming the side mirror forms a crucial layer for paint adhesion, enhancing the durability of the paint job. Apply a high-quality primer suitable for your mirror’s material and let it dry as per manufacturer’s instructions. Achieving a uniform coat without drips sets a solid foundation for painting.

Next, focus on applying paint in even strokes for a consistent coat. It’s recommended to use spray paint designed for automotive use, moving back and forth in a controlled manner to avoid runs. Apply multiple thin coats instead of one thick layer, letting each coat dry completely before applying the next.

Finally, patience is key when allowing the paint to dry thoroughly. A strong and durable finish depends on the paint’s complete adhesion to the side mirror. Adhering to recommended drying times, usually found in the paint’s instructions, yields the best results and prevents blemishes.

Finishing Touches

Applying a clear coat is essential for shielding the paint from external elements and UV rays. Begin with a light coat, ensuring even coverage over the entire surface of the side mirror. Allow sufficient drying time before adding a second, heavier coat for optimal protection.

Once the clear coat dries, buffing and polishing come into play. Use a soft, clean microfiber cloth for buffing and a high-quality polishing compound. These steps will not only impart a smooth, shiny finish but also eliminate any minor imperfections from the painted surface.

With the mirror’s surface flawlessly polished, focus on reinstalling the side mirror on the vehicle. It’s imperative to handle the mirror gently to prevent scratches. Ensure all connections are secure and tight, restoring the side mirror to its original function and appearance.

Frequently Asked Questions Of How To Paint A Side Mirror

How Do You Paint A Car Side Mirror?

To paint a car side mirror, start by removing it and cleaning thoroughly. Sand the surface for adhesion, then apply a primer. Once dry, spray an even coat of paint. Finish with a clear protective lacquer. Let it fully cure before reattaching to the car.

What Kind Of Paint Do You Use On Mirrors?

Use oil-based paints or acrylic paints specially formulated for glass and mirror surfaces to achieve the best adhesion and finish. Ensure the mirror is clean before application for optimal results.

How Do You Paint A Primed Wing Mirror?

Clean the primed wing mirror thoroughly. Tape off areas to avoid overspray. Apply even, thin coats of automotive paint. Let each layer dry completely. Finish with a clear coat for protection and shine.
